Breath Alcohol Testing

Breath alcohol testing (BAT) assesses the amount of alcohol in a person’s breath, providing an estimate of blood alcohol content (BAC). Often used by law enforcement, this non-invasive method delivers immediate results. In Dell, Montana, breath testing is critical for roadside and workplace screenings.

ETG/ETS Alcohol Testing

ETG/ETS Alcohol Testing detects ethyl glucuronide and ethyl sulfate, substances indicative of alcohol intake. In Dell, Montana, this sensitive testing identifies consumption even after the alcohol is metabolized, offering a longer detection period than most methods.

Breath alcohol testing is commonly used for both DOT and non-DOT workplace compliance because it can document an exact alcohol concentration.
Alcohol testing is frequently required after a workplace accident, when there is reasonable suspicion of on-duty impairment, before an employee returns to duty after an alcohol policy violation, as part of random testing pools for regulated safety-sensitive positions, and for court, probation, or program compliance.
Breath alcohol testing can generate an immediate reading of alcohol concentration and, in the case of evidential breath testing, produce a documented result that can be used to support policy action or regulatory compliance. Saliva screening can also provide rapid indication of alcohol presence.
